首页 / 大硬盘VPS推荐 / 正文
Oracle 10g安装指南,从零开始搭建企业级数据库环境,oracle10g安装教程

Time:2025年04月15日 Read:17 评论:0 作者:y21dr45

(约2300字)


Oracle 10g简介与适用场景

Oracle 10g(全称Oracle Database 10g Release 2)是甲骨文公司于2003年推出的经典数据库版本,其核心特性包括自动化管理、网格计算支持和增强的高可用性,尽管当前主流版本已迭代至Oracle 19c或21c,但仍有部分企业因历史系统兼容性、成本控制或特定业务需求选择使用Oracle 10g,本文将通过详细图文步骤,帮助用户完成从环境准备到数据库实例创建的完整流程。


安装前的准备工作

Oracle 10g安装指南,从零开始搭建企业级数据库环境,oracle10g安装教程

系统环境要求

  • 操作系统:支持Windows Server 2003/2008、Linux(Red Hat Enterprise Linux 4/5、SUSE Linux Enterprise Server 9/10)。
  • 硬件最低配置
    • CPU:1 GHz或以上
    • 内存:1 GB(建议2 GB)
    • 硬盘空间:安装目录至少5 GB,数据文件需额外预留
    • 虚拟内存:建议设置为物理内存的2倍

软件依赖项

  • 对于Linux系统,需预装以下依赖包:
    # Red Hat/CentOS示例
    yum install binutils compat-libstdc++-33 gcc glibc glibc-common libaio libgcc libstdc++ make sysstat
  • 创建Oracle用户与组:
    groupadd oinstall
    groupadd dba
    useradd -g oinstall -G dba oracle
    passwd oracle

内核参数调优(Linux)
修改/etc/sysctl.conf文件以优化性能:

kernel.shmall = 2097152
kernel.shmmax = 536870912
fs.file-max = 65536
net.ipv4.ip_local_port_range = 1024 65000

执行sysctl -p生效。


详细安装步骤(以Linux为例)

解压安装包并配置环境变量

  • 将安装文件10201_database_linux32.zip解压至/opt/oracle
    unzip 10201_database_linux32.zip -d /opt/oracle
  • 设置Oracle用户环境变量(~/.bash_profile):
    export ORACLE_BASE=/opt/oracle
    export ORACLE_HOME=$ORACLE_BASE/product/10.2.0/db_1
    export PATH=$PATH:$ORACLE_HOME/bin
    export LD_LIBRARY_PATH=$ORACLE_HOME/lib:/usr/lib

启动图形化安装界面

  • oracle用户登录,运行安装脚本:
    cd /opt/oracle/database
    ./runInstaller
  • 若出现图形界面无法启动,需检查X11转发或安装VNC服务。

安装流程分步解析

  1. 选择安装类型:建议选择“企业版”以获取完整功能。
  2. 指定安装路径:默认使用ORACLE_HOME路径,保持一致性。
  3. 配置清单文件:生成oraInventory目录,记录安装日志。
  4. 选择数据库配置:选择“仅安装软件”,后续手动创建数据库。
  5. 权限配置:确保oracle用户对目录有读写权限。
  6. 执行预安装检查:根据提示修复缺失的依赖项。
  7. 完成安装:最后运行root.sh脚本以配置系统服务。

创建数据库实例(手动配置)

使用DBCA工具

  • 运行Database Configuration Assistant(DBCA):
    dbca
  • 配置步骤
    • 选择“创建数据库”
    • 模板选择“一般用途”
    • 设置全局数据库名(如orcl)和SID
    • 配置内存分配(建议初始1 GB)
    • 指定数据文件存储路径(使用ASM或文件系统)
    • 启用归档日志模式(可选)
    • 创建完成后生成启动脚本

验证数据库状态

sqlplus / as sysdba
SQL> SELECT name, open_mode FROM v$database;
SQL> SELECT * FROM v$version;

常见问题与解决方案

  1. OUI-25031错误:因缺少libXp.so.6包导致,安装libXp后重试。
  2. 监听程序启动失败:检查listener.oratnsnames.ora配置的IP与端口。
  3. ORA-12154 TNS解析错误:验证ORACLE_SID是否与实例名一致。
  4. 内存不足导致安装中断:关闭非必要进程或增加Swap分区。

安全加固与日常维护建议

  1. 修改默认密码:立即更改SYSSYSTEMDBSNMP等账户密码。
  2. 启用审计功能
    ALTER SYSTEM SET audit_trail=DB SCOPE=SPFILE;
  3. 定期备份策略:结合RMAN工具实现全备与增量备份。
  4. 监控性能指标:使用AWR报告或OEM(Oracle Enterprise Manager)分析负载。

Oracle 10g的安装过程虽涉及较多技术细节,但通过系统化的准备与分步实施,仍可高效完成部署,对于仍在使用此版本的企业,建议评估升级至受支持版本的必要性,以规避潜在安全风险,掌握10g的安装与配置,也能为后续学习高版本Oracle数据库奠定坚实基础。

排行榜
关于我们
「好主机」服务器测评网专注于为用户提供专业、真实的服务器评测与高性价比推荐。我们通过硬核性能测试、稳定性追踪及用户真实评价,帮助企业和个人用户快速找到最适合的服务器解决方案。无论是云服务器、物理服务器还是企业级服务器,好主机都是您值得信赖的选购指南!
快捷菜单1
服务器测评
VPS测评
VPS测评
服务器资讯
服务器资讯
扫码关注
鲁ICP备2022041413号-1